Garden Waste Subscription Service Terms and Conditions

This agreement is made between the person making the application (the customer) and Oxford City Council (the council), and sets out the terms and conditions under which the customer may use the Council's Garden Waste Brown Bin Subscription fortnightly collection service.

1.    The Garden Waste Brown Bin subscription service ('the Service') is available to the customer, on payment to the council of the applicable subscription, for a period of 12 months starting on the Start Date.  Subject to the terms of this agreement, the Service will be provided on a fortnightly basis.

2.    The customer may use the Service for the collection of all items of garden waste as specified by the council from time to time (currently as set out in the Council's booklet 'Managing Your Waste'.  The customer may use the Service for the collection of no other materials.

3.    If any other waste is presented for collection it will not be collected, and the council may consider this agreement to be immediately terminated.

4.    In using the Service, the customer may only use the designated garden waste container ('the Container') provided by the council. The council will not collect garden waste contained in any other container.  The Container shall remain the property of the council at all times.

5.    Garden waste must be presented kerbside in the Container by 7am on the day of collection from an accessible and clearly visible and accessible to our crews, being placed as close to where your property meets the publicly adopted highway/pavement as possible (or where your property meets the private road that we have agreed to service as by existing collections).

6.    The Container should be removed from the public highway (including associated pavements / footways / verges etc) as soon as possible after collection but no later than 7:00pm on the day of collection.

7.    Lids of wheeled Containers containing garden waste must be fully closed. The council reserves the right not to empty Containers when the lids are not fully closed as this may cause damage to the lids whilst being mechanically emptied.

8.    The council reserves the right not to empty / collect any Container that in its reasonable opinion poses a health and safety risk to operatives or exceeds a weight of 25kg, and may require the customer to reduce the weight in the Container before any further attempt to empty / collect is undertaken.

9.    The Service will not be provided over the Christmas / New Year period.  The Service will also not be provided in the event that the council is unable to provide it due to circumstances beyond its control or other force majeure.

10.    Prior to the end of the 12 month term of this agreement, the council may send out a new agreement asking the customer to renew their entitlement to the Service.  This must be returned, with full payment, in order for the Service to continue for the next 12 months. If the new agreement, together with full payment,  is not returned prior to the expiration of the current agreement, the council will assume that the customer no longer requires the Service and the council will therefore collect the Container from the customer's property within 14 days of the date of expiry of the agreement. If the Container is deemed by council staff not to be accessible, the customer will be invoiced for the full cost of a replacement Container and any associated costs of the aborted collection. Such costs shall be payable by the customer to the council on demand and shall be recoverable by the council as a debt.

11.    The council generally reviews its Service charge annually, effective from the first of April, but reserves the right to vary charges with reasonable notice at any time.

12.    During the currency of this agreement the applicant shall be responsible for the Container provided, its cleanliness and the cleanliness of the site around the Container.

13.    The applicant shall keep the Container safe and secure. In the event of the Container being lost, stolen or damaged the customer may be required to pay the council the cost of an equivalent replacement Container and its delivery. Such costs shall be payable by the customer to the council on demand and shall be recoverable by the council as a debt. The council will carry out routine repairs to Containers where the council reasonably considers this is necessary due to normal wear and tear.

14.    On termination of the customer's entitlement to the Service (however such termination occurred) the council reserves the right to enter the customer's premises/property to recover the Container.

15.    This agreement includes the duty of care for the fortnightly removal of garden waste in accordance with Section 34 of the Environmental Protection Act 1990. (For information: It is unlawful to transfer or dispose of waste for which there is no waste transfer note pertaining to that waste. It is also unlawful for the carrier to transfer or dispose of waste for which there is no waste transfer.)
